WebJul 31, 2024 · Burger or sandwich bar – generally, you should include options for bread, meat, toppings, and spreads in a burger or sandwich bar. For bread, you may opt for homemade hamburger buns, focaccia, pita bread, and more. Common meat choices are chicken patties, bacon, grilled chicken, and so on.
